The
Action Quake2 Map Depot has moved. It seems their old host,
Battle-Zone is closing their doors, and they're taking shelter
over here at Telefragged. There new site is located at aqmd.telefragged.com,
be sure to check it out. They promise a slew of new maps upon
their full arrival to the new location, so check back there
really soon. All of the links have been updated.

The
Actor's Guild inventory is really piling up. Over there
now are 4 new gun models, an Uzi replacing the Mp5, AK-47 replacing
the M4, new looking Sniper Rifle, and a Tommy Gun for the M4.
Also, there are about 20 new skins available for download. Keep
checking back here for all the updates. That site is really
picking up some momentum.

Capture the Briefcase
is now being run on Fool's Paradise (lostinfo.com). Go on over
there for an early look at the code. It's not near finished,
but this should give you and idea of what the AQDT (Action Quake
Development Team) has planned. Read all about it at the official
AQDT Page.
